Correggere gli errori 404 su WordPress

WordPress è un potente CMS. A volte un piccolo ritocco può rendere il tuo sito web inaccessibile in alcuni suoi punti restituendo gli errori 404. ecco come correggere gli errori 404 su WordPress

Tuttavia, trovare soluzione per ogni errore su WordPress è estremamente semplice (controlla come richiedere correttamente il supporto per WordPress e ottenerlo). In passato abbiamo trattato alcuni dei problemi più comuni che gli utenti di WordPress affrontano. Come l’errore interno  del server o l’errore di connessione al database. Un altro problema comune a cui la maggior parte degli utenti di WordPress si trova ad un certo punto sono i messaggi WordPress che restituiscono un errore 404. In questo articolo ti mostreremo come correggere i messaggi di WordPress restituendo un errore 404.

Di solito in questo scenario un utente può accedere alla propria area admin di WordPress, o alla pagina principale del proprio blog, ma quando cerca di accedere ad un singolo post riceve un errore 404 (Pagina Non trovata). Prima di tutto, non farti prendere dal panico quasi sempre i tuoi post sono ancora lì e sono completamente al sicuro. Questo di solito accade se il tuo file .htaccess viene cancellato o qualcosa è andato storto con le regole di riscrittura. Quello che devi fare è correggere le impostazioni dei permalink.

Vai su Impostazioni »Permalink e fai semplicemente clic sul pulsante Salva modifiche.

aggiorna permalinks

Questo aggiornerà le impostazioni dei permalink e le regole di riscrittura. Nella maggior parte dei casi questa soluzione corregge l’errore 404 di WordPress.

Tuttavia, se non funziona nel tuo caso, probabilmente devi aggiornare manualmente il tuo file .htaccess.

Accedi quindi al tuo server usando FTP e modifica il file .htaccess che si trova nella stessa posizione in cui si trovano cartelle come / wp-content / e / wp-includes /. La cosa più semplice che puoi fare è rendere temporaneamente scrivibile il file cambiando le autorizzazioni in 666. Quindi ripeti la soluzione originale. Non dimenticare di cambiare le autorizzazioni di nuovo a 660. Puoi anche aggiungere manualmente questo codice nel tuo file .htaccess:

1
2
3
4
5
6
7
8
9
10
# BEGIN WordPress
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
# END WordPress

Soluzioni per installazioni in locale

Spesso i webmaster installano WordPress sui loro computer utilizzando un server locale a scopo di test. Se desideri utilizzare dei bei permalink, è necessario abilitare rewrite_module nella configurazione Apache di MAMP, WAMP o XXAMP.

Abbiamo scritto un tutorial qui su come abilitare i permalink personalizzati nell’ambiente locale di WordPress.

Speriamo che questo articolo ti abbia aiutato a risolvere i post con errori 404 errori su WordPress. Questa soluzione ha funzionato per te? Hai un’altra soluzione che ha funzionato per te? Condividila nei commenti qui sotto. Vorremmo rendere questo articolo una risorsa completa per gli utenti che si imbattono in questo problema.